Kentucky environmental attorney Sanders says Chemical Safety Board will hold public meeting on February 4, 2010 in Raleigh, NC on Conagra explosion.

The U.S. Chemical Safety Board will hold a public meeting on Thursday, February 4, 2010, in Raleigh, North Carolina, to present preliminary findings from its investigation of the June 9, 2009, natural gas explosion and ammonia release at the ConAgra Food Slim Jim facility in Garner, North Carolina, that killed four workers and injured seventy others.

 The meeting will begin at 6:00 p.m. at the Raleigh Sheraton Ballroom located at 421 South Salisbury Street in downtown Raleigh. The meeting is free and open to the public.
